The Americana is great value for your money. While the rooms are nothing fancy, and the TV channels very few, it is a clean place to rest your hear while having fun in the Falls. Rooms come with a mini fridge and a microwave. Make sure to bring all your toiletries as they come with a two in one shampoo commercial despenser in the shower. No creams, shower gels or tissues. The staff are all so lovely. Not one was unpleasant from the front desk to the pool restaurants to the life guards. The waterpark while smaller, is perfect if you have kids under 12 and you want to have eyes on them at all times. There are 4 very fun waterslides, a warm (so important!) wave pool that is shallow- My 6 year old almost touched bottom at the very back- and a great little splash/waterslide area for the smallest kids in tow. The arcade was mediocre and overpriced but thats to be expected in these kinds of places. There is a grocery store in the adjacent parking lot and many restaurants within walking or driving distance without having to head into the chaos of Clifton Hill. We ate at Johnny Roccos- a 4 minute drive away from the crazy tourist area, with excellent food and great service. Overall, a fantastic overnight and fun experience in the falls.

Let me tell you about my experiences as a disabled individual. To begin with, we were seniors traveling with a bus trip from Indiana; I require a motorized scooter as I have limited walking abilities. The scooter was unloaded from under the bus at each stop. I take it to my room each night to plug it in and recharge it. There are steps at the front door of the hotel, and the ramp and handicap entrance are over on the side in a different area. I am fairly independent and had a single room. The door between my room and the hall was very heavy and snaps shut very quickly, making it difficult to enter and exit. It was a struggle. The breakfast area was very crowded when we were there, as there were several busses and it was difficult to get through the line. I was able to tip one of the workers to help fill a breakfast plate for me and bring it to me in the Bistro. The big problem was in the mornings when the bus was loading at the front doors (with steps) and I had to exit through the side door. I pushed the handicap button to open the door; first door opened into a little lobby. I pushed the second button to open the door to the outside; it clicked, but didn't open. Three times I tried! I was trapped in the little lobby and all the people were on the bus except me! Panic! I reported to the desk the handicap button to open up was broken, but no one ever fixed it. Next day--same thing! I have learned through traveling in the past to move a chair into the bathroom so I can better access the toilet and shower, so I am thankful for the lightweight moveable chair that I was able to use, as there is nothing for the elderly to hang onto in the bathroom.
